在探讨硬件产品经理与软件产品经理之间谁更难的问题时,我们需要从多个角度进行深入分析。虽然两者都面临着不同的挑战,但它们各自的工作性质和要求使得在某些方面硬件产品经理可能比软件产品经理更具挑战性。
1. 技术理解深度与广度
硬件产品经理需要对硬件有深入的理解和全面的了解,这包括电子学、机械工程、材料科学等。他们不仅需要理解产品的物理特性,还需要能够预测和解决可能出现的技术问题。这种对技术的全面掌握使得硬件产品经理在面对技术难题时能迅速找到解决方案,从而提高工作效率。
相比之下,软件产品经理虽然也需要对编程和软件开发有一定的了解,但他们的工作更多地集中在产品设计、用户体验、市场策略等方面。软件产品经理需要具备较强的逻辑思维能力和创新能力,以便在不断变化的软件市场中保持竞争力。
2. 项目管理能力
硬件产品经理通常负责整个硬件产品的开发过程,包括需求分析、设计、测试、生产等各个环节。这要求他们不仅要有出色的技术能力,还要具备强大的项目管理能力,以确保项目按时交付且质量达标。此外,硬件产品往往涉及复杂的供应链管理,硬件产品经理还需要具备良好的供应商管理能力,以确保零部件的稳定供应。
相比之下,软件产品经理虽然也需要关注项目管理,但他们更多地聚焦于软件产品的生命周期管理,包括需求分析、设计、开发、测试、部署和维护等环节。软件产品经理需要具备一定的技术背景,以便更好地与技术团队沟通协作。
3. 跨领域合作
硬件产品经理需要与多个领域的专家进行合作,包括硬件工程师、电子工程师、结构工程师等。这些合作伙伴可能来自不同的专业背景,他们的工作方式和思维模式可能存在差异。因此,硬件产品经理需要具备良好的沟通能力和协调能力,以便在不同领域之间建立有效的合作关系,推动项目的顺利进行。
相比之下,软件产品经理虽然也需要与其他团队成员(如开发人员、设计师、测试人员等)紧密合作,但他们的合作更多是基于共同的目标和任务。软件产品经理需要具备较强的团队协作能力,以便在团队内部形成良好的工作氛围和高效的工作流程。
4. 创新与适应变化
硬件产品往往具有更高的技术含量和更复杂的功能,这使得硬件产品经理需要不断地学习和掌握新技术,以保持产品的竞争力。同时,硬件产品需要适应不断变化的市场环境,因此硬件产品经理需要具备敏锐的市场洞察力和快速应变的能力。
相比之下,软件产品经理虽然也需要关注产品的技术创新和市场变化,但他们更多的是通过不断优化产品功能和提升用户体验来应对竞争。软件产品经理需要具备较强的学习能力和自我驱动力,以便在不断变化的软件市场中保持领先地位。
5. 商业敏感性与市场洞察
硬件产品经理需要具备较强的商业敏感性和市场洞察力,以便在产品设计阶段就充分考虑到市场需求和竞争态势。他们需要了解不同行业的特点和趋势,以便制定出符合市场需求的产品策略。
相比之下,软件产品经理虽然也需要关注市场动态和用户需求,但他们更多地聚焦于软件产品的功能性和稳定性。软件产品经理需要具备较强的逻辑思维能力和创新能力,以便在不断变化的软件市场中保持竞争力。
综上所述,硬件产品经理与软件产品经理在工作性质、技能要求和挑战方面存在显著差异。虽然两者都需要具备深厚的技术知识和良好的沟通协作能力,但在项目管理、跨领域合作、创新与适应变化以及商业敏感性与市场洞察等方面,硬件产品经理面临的挑战更为复杂和艰巨。因此,对于希望成为硬件产品经理的人来说,需要在技术、管理等多方面全面提升自己的能力;而对于希望成为软件产品经理的人来说,则需要更加专注于提升自己的技术能力和逻辑思维能力。